Hostos Community College grants degrees
at the end of each fall and spring term and summer session.
Commencement ceremonies are held twice each year: in
January, to recognize degrees awarded the preceding summer
and fall, and in June, to recognize students completing
their degrees in the spring.
Students whose records indicate they are
on schedule to graduate at the end of the term are invited
to commencement. Students whose records indicate that degree
requirements cannot be completed in advance of commencement
will have to wait for a later ceremony and reapply for
graduation at the appropriate time.
Students planning to graduate at a
particular time are responsible for maintaining an
appropriate course
load and completing degree requirements.
